Execution, Authoring and Integration
Integration business rules engine (BRE) in .NET Standard 2.0 or JavaScript applications. REST API integration is also available for other technologies. Web Widgets allow a rules authoring experience to be exposed via your application.
Flexible and Extensible Business Rule
FlexRule's BRE supports backward and forward chaining. The BRE is flexible and can be extended using your own custom code. .NET assemblies can be referenced and custom types and members can be invoked.
Simulate, Monitor and Measure
Allow step-by-step live interaction with models by passing input and output parameters for simulation, debugging and analysis purposes. Enable your business to track and measure decision results based on KPIs.

Decision Tables
Model Decision Logic: Multiple Techniques in Modeling Decision Logic
Decision Tables are a powerful declarative method of modeling decision logic. It enables you to simply import existing Spreadsheet documents (e.g. Microsoft Excel, Google Doc…) and bring them to life!
You simply validate them with synthetic and semantic validation to identify errors, rule overlaps and conflicts at design time. They support standard and custom aggregation functions.
Web Components
Integrate Rule Editor into Your Web Application
Our Business Rules Engine provides web components to integrate the authoring experience of business rules into your web application.
Web Components in JavaScript enables authoring (i.e. create new, change, update, etc.) of business rules in a Decision Table or Natural Language within any web technologies such as REACT, vanilla JS and etc.
These web components are built to give your application flexibility of exposing the rules editor to your end user without the need to force your clients leave your application.

Version and Change Management
Maintain Change History and Run Multiple Versions
Versioning is not a trivial task when it comes to business rules. Our Business Rule Management System enables you to record and track changes to business rules seamlessly. While modeling, our version control system allows you to keep track of all changes without even having to think about it.
In Production, Staging, Testing and other environments, you can run multiple versions of your business rules simultaneously. Switch to a different version of your services and pin a specific version down for different environments (e.g. production, staging, or testing).
Manage your environment and promote business rules into different environments with a just single click.
